Wall Maintenance



Evaluating wall surfaces for any kind of blemishes and immediately resolving them with necessary repair work is critical for attaining a smooth and flawless paint job. Prior to starting the painting process, meticulously take a look at the wall surfaces for splits, holes, dents, or any other damage that can impact the result.

Beginning by completing any kind of cracks or openings with spackling substance, enabling it to dry totally prior to sanding it to produce a smooth surface. For larger damages or harmed locations, take into consideration making use of joint substance to ensure a smooth fixing.

Furthermore, look for any kind of loose paint or wallpaper that might require to be gotten rid of. Scrape off any type of peeling off paint or old wallpaper, and sand the surface area to develop an uniform texture.

It's additionally necessary to check for water damages, as this can result in mold development and affect the adhesion of the new paint. Attend to any kind of water discolorations or mold with the suitable cleaning remedies prior to waging the painting process.

Cleansing and Surface Prep Work



To make certain a beautiful and well-prepared surface area for paint, the following action includes extensively cleaning and prepping the wall surfaces. Begin by dusting the wall surfaces with a microfiber cloth or a duster to remove any type of loose dust, webs, or debris.

For more persistent dirt or gunk, a remedy of light cleaning agent and water can be made use of to carefully scrub the walls, followed by an extensive rinse with tidy water. Pay unique interest to areas near light buttons, door handles, and baseboards, as these tend to collect more dust.

After cleaning, it is essential to check the walls for any kind of splits, openings, or flaws. These must be loaded with spackling compound and sanded smooth as soon as completely dry.
